Public safety power shutoffs considered for some SCE customers

Some Southern California Edison customers could have their power turned off as potentially dangerous fire weather conditions develop during a week of extreme heat.

Public Safety Power Shutoffs allow power to be cut in areas where strong winds could damage electrical lines and spark fast-moving wildfires.

Shutoffs are being considered for nearly 4,000 customers in Los Angeles County, according to SCE’s web site. The areas under consideration are mainly in the area near Malibu and the Santa Monica Mountains Recreational Area and in northern areas such as Castaic and Sandberg…
